Coderity
Coderity is an "out of the box" CMS for the CakePHP framework, available on GitHub under the MIT license. Elegant, simple to use and install, Coderity provides a easy to use, straight forward Content Management System for CakePHP 2. Coderity is useful if you are looking for an out of the box, simple to use CakePHP CMS, which can be expanded and made your own! Features include: - Pages management - add, edit and delete pages. - Drag and drop ordering of the navigation menu, with the option to select which pages show in the top and bottom menu. - Site Blocks - Set general content global area's - such as header and footer sections, - Blog - add, edit and delete blog articles. - Contact Form and Leads Management. - Manage Admin Users. - Redirects - add, edit and delete 301 redirects. - General Settings - control the overall site settings, - Easy installer.

Creating an Event Manager in CakePHP
The main idea of our tutorial is to create a simple Events Manager using CakePHP. Our project will: * Create / Update / Deleting events with or without attached location (This is often called a CRUD style application) * Create / Update / Delete locations * Show all events in a list view or calendar view * Provide an RSS feed for all events

Cook up Web sites fast with CakePHP
This "Cook up Web sites fast with CakePHP" series is designed for PHP application developers who want to start using CakePHP to make their lives easier. In the end, you will have learned how to install and configure CakePHP, the basics of Model-View-Controller (MVC) design, how to validate user data in CakePHP, how to use CakePHP helpers, and how to get an application up and running quickly using CakePHP.

CakePHP Application Development
This book offers step-by-step instructions to learn the CakePHP framework and to quickly develop and deploy web-based applications. It introduces the MVC pattern and coding styles using practical examples. It takes the developer through setting up a CakePHP development and deployment environment, and develops an example application to illustrate all of the techniques you need to write a complete, non-trivial application in PHP. It aims to assist PHP programmers to rapidly develop and deploy well-crafted and robust web-based applications with CakePHP.

Infinitas
posted byhsbotinCakePHP CMS
Infinitas is an open source content management system that was developed using the CakePHP v1.3 framework. Amongst other things, its a blog, cms, newsletter emailing system and on-line shopping cart.
